Xandros Server Standard Edition 2. "
The latest Xandros server is
meant for use by small and midsize businesses. In particular, the company
is aiming it at Windows administrators who want to minimize down-time and
cut support costs, according to the company. The new Xandros Linux server
is compatible with existing Windows domain and networking topologies. It
provides an alternative for Windows administrators looking to replace older
versions of Windows server, and it offers the ability to remotely manage
Linux servers even from a Windows desktop, through the all-graphical xMC
(Xandros Management Console)."
